Closed Bug 1400817 Opened 7 years ago Closed 7 years ago

Nightly on Linux does not show same GTK font weight for Tab names and Profile Manager as FF 55.0.3

Categories

(Core :: Widget: Gtk, defect)

57 Branch
Unspecified
Linux
defect
Not set
normal

Tracking

()

RESOLVED WONTFIX

People

(Reporter: smurfd, Unassigned)

References

Details

Attachments

(2 files)

User Agent: Mozilla/5.0 (Windows NT 6.3; Win64; x64; rv:55.0) Gecko/20100101 Firefox/55.0
Build ID: 20170824053622

Steps to reproduce:

Have your GTK/GNOME font set to a bold font.

Start Firefox Nightly with Profile Manager (already at this point you should see, if you compare to FF 55.0.3 that the font has changed for the whole profile manager ie all elements)

choose your profile
Then you will also see that the font is different on the Tabs names where it now when im entering this bug says "Enter A Bug"


Actual results:

The font shown for tabs names and Profile managers gtk elements are different compared to my other GTK apps and what FF 55.0.3 shows. 

I also noticed the same issue in Thunderbird Daily 
All this is since maby a week or so back... not sure about exact date
(Can attach screenshots later ...  if nessesairy)


Expected results:

If you have choosen a Bold font in GNOME / GTK you should have that on the tabs names and in the profilemanager(that shows up when you start Firefox) aswell...
Component: Untriaged → Widget: Gtk
OS: Unspecified → Linux
Product: Firefox → Core
Attached image nightlytotheright.png (deleted) —
Added screenshots from both FF 55.0.3 and from Nightly
55.0.3 to the left and Nightly to the right both tab and Profile manager
The change in behavior would be due to https://hg.mozilla.org/mozilla-central/rev/143ef903d8f6

I can reproduce that by setting "gtk-font-name=DejaVu Sans Bold 10" in ~/.config/gtk-3.0/settings.ini, but I can't find that producing a bold font in gtk3-demo or gtk3-widget-factory.

It seems that the new behavior more closely follows that of GTK3.

(In reply to Nicklas Boman from comment #0)
> The font shown for tabs names and Profile managers gtk elements are
> different compared to my other GTK apps [...]

In which GTK apps are you seeing a bold font?
Are any of these using GTK3?
What is the version of libgtk-3?
Blocks: 1384701
Summary: Nightly on Linux does not show same GTK font for Tabs names and Profile Manager as FF 55.0.3 → Nightly on Linux does not show same GTK font weight for Tab names and Profile Manager as FF 55.0.3
Attached image Untitled.png (deleted) —
@karlt you are right. 
Nightly follows the font that i have set in GNOME/GTK more closely than earlier Firefox.
If i have set a bold font, it would show up in like gedit if you open a new tab, the tabs name in the tab would be bold... 
(But it is not the actual Bold thing i was looking for, rather the font i have set in GTK, to show this more clearly i set it to Bold...)


this is what my gtk3-widget-factory looks like...see above attachment
and i thought first that Firefox should have the same fonts as "Page 1" 


So i think we are done here, can i close this bug somehow or?
Thanks.  I'll mark this as WONTFIX.

Adwaita 3.22 uses a bold font for tabs, even when gtk-font-name is not bold.
It would be possible to make Firefox follow GTK's tab font and weight in
Firefox tabs, but it would be clearer to file a new bug to request that
change.  That probably won't be WONTFIX, but it's likely not bad enough get
attention, and so would need someone to offer to implement.
Status: UNCONFIRMED → RESOLVED
Closed: 7 years ago
Resolution: --- → WONTFIX
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: